Depending on the firearm, gunshots can range between 140-190dB. If you’re not familiar with dB levels, normal conversation is around 50dB, a vacuum cleaner /hair dryer average about 70dB while a lawn mower is 90dB. A single gunshot is louder than a rock concert (120dB) and a jackhammer (130dB). It actually ranks up there with a jet plane takeoff! Sounds THAT loud can cause &lt;strong&gt;instantaneous permanent damage to your hearing&lt;/strong&gt;.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;a href="http://2.bp.blogspot.com/-Oni--NmPSlc/TlQlvVVCBII/AAAAAAAAAG4/cg4sR0z--n4/s1600/Rifle.jpg"&gt;&lt;img style="display:block; margin:0px auto 10px; text-align:center;cursor:pointer; cursor:hand;width: 150px; height: 99px;" src="http://2.bp.blogspot.com/-Oni--NmPSlc/TlQlvVVCBII/AAAAAAAAAG4/cg4sR0z--n4/s320/Rifle.jpg" border="0" alt=""id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5644177728111510658"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;People are good at wearing hearing protection at firing ranges because there is a steady exposure to gunshots but people don’t think about a single shot damaging their hearing. Hearing protection is a good idea whenever you are exposed to loud sounds. &l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Thankfully, multiple hearing protection options have been specifically designed for hunters. Q-Tips are great for cleaning the outside of your ear and right inside the canal. It is just not safe to aggressively dig a stick with cotton on the tip into your ear. I know it feels good (yes I am talking to you Mom) but it is NOT SAFE to go too deep. If you actually look at the Q-Tip box, ears aren’t even a suggested use.&lt;a onblur="try {parent.deselectBloggerImageGracefully();} catch(e) {}" href="http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_2mLelKdrmnE/TAAgWhkjGPI/AAAAAAAAADM/MIIrJTuxduM/s1600/Q+Tips.jpg"&gt;&lt;img style="float:right; margin:0 0 10px 10px;cursor:pointer; cursor:hand;width: 123px; height: 98px;" src="http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_2mLelKdrmnE/TAAgWhkjGPI/AAAAAAAAADM/MIIrJTuxduM/s320/Q+Tips.jpg" border="0" alt=""id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5476412718223399154"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;· Let very hot or very cold water run into your ear canals when you are in the shower. You can let water run in your ears but make sure the water is warm.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-weight:bold;"&gt;Do...&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;· Let wax come out of your naturally. Wax is secreted by the body to keep dust, dirt, hair and other things AWAY from the eardrum. If you go sticking things into your ear, you could push the wax back too far.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;· Use drops to soften hard plugged wax. You can use over-the-counter drops like Debrox or something found at home like olive oil.&lt;a onblur="try {parent.deselectBloggerImageGracefully();} catch(e) {}" href="http://2.bp.blogspot.com/_2mLelKdrmnE/TAAe5cySYoI/AAAAAAAAACs/cGftWPUjWrU/s1600/Debrox.jpg"&gt;&lt;img style="float:right; margin:0 0 10px 10px;cursor:pointer; cursor:hand;width: 116px; height: 116px;" src="http://2.bp.blogspot.com/_2mLelKdrmnE/TAAe5cySYoI/AAAAAAAAACs/cGftWPUjWrU/s320/Debrox.jpg" border="0" alt=""id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5476411119211012738"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;· Use an easy flush of you want to keep your ears clean. You can use a solution of one part warm water and one part vinegar or hydrogen peroxide. Using a bulb syringe (the kind you use on infants) suck up the solution and flush your ears. You want to tilt your head down on the side you are flushing so the solution shoots up and falls back out of the ear.&lt;a onblur="try {parent.deselectBloggerImageGracefully();} catch(e) {}" href="http://3.bp.blogspot.com/_2mLelKdrmnE/TAAfGwZlxbI/AAAAAAAAAC0/53-Iqt6fSZA/s1600/bulb+syringe.jpg"&gt;&lt;img style="float:right; margin:0 0 10px 10px;cursor:pointer; cursor:hand;width: 118px; height: 94px;" src="http://3.bp.blogspot.com/_2mLelKdrmnE/TAAfGwZlxbI/AAAAAAAAAC0/53-Iqt6fSZA/s320/bulb+syringe.jpg" border="0" alt=""id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5476411347814434226"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;· Go to a professional for wax removal if the wax becomes impacted (plugged). &l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;There you have it. What they may not be aware of is just how damaging those loud sounds can be to their hearing or that custom hearing protection is available and very easy to use.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Drug store foam earplugs are made for the masses. They are a one-size-fits-most quick solution to blocking loud sounds by acting like a plug in the ear. Coming from someone who looks in ears all day long, I can tell you that no two ear canals are the same. Some are wide while others are narrow. Some have deep curves and some are pretty straight. Each canal also has a different depth. Although drug store foam plugs are better than nothing, they just don’t always do the trick. Have you ever tried these foam plugs only to have them fall out of your ears within a short amount of time? Even when they are squeezed down to a thin layer of foam, shoved into the canal and held in place to allow the plug to expand, they can easily work their way out of the ear with jaw movement. Other people may experience soreness in their ears due to inappropriate sizes of plugs.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;If you have tried the foam plugs and they seem to work, continue to wear them whenever you are exposed to loud sounds. Like I stated before: any protection is better then no protection at all. For the majority of people who cannot use the foam earplugs, there is a solution: custom hearing protection. A recent study conducted by Hear the Word, an organization created to raise awareness of hearing-related issues globally, found that hearing aids were coupled with “old age” more than any other accessory included in the survey. These other accessories were wheelchairs, glasses, crutches and canes for the blind.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Interestingly, 93% of people surveyed claimed they would wear a hearing aid if needed, however, previous research shows that people who have a hearing loss do not wearing hearing aids. The survey also found that one of the top three reasons for not wearing hearing aids is the person does not want to admit having a hearing loss. &l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;With all of the amazing advancements in hearing aid technology, hearing aids are smaller and better then ever before. But the stigma that hearing aids are for “old people” is keeping many of the 700 million people worldwide living with hearing loss form getting the help they need.
